A mother from Florida claims that her son was suspended from school after administrators discovered her OnlyFans account.

Sara Blake Cheek revealed that she was forced to homeschool her seven-year-old son after school officials discovered she had an OnlyFans account and suspended him. Cheek stated that she attempted to meet with the principal. Nonetheless, she allegedly refused to speak with her. “My son was even suspended from school, and in trying to communicate with the principal, she refused to talk to me or give a reason as to why he was being treated badly simply because I did OnlyFans,” Cheek explained.

According to Dexerto, Cheek also advocated for fellow OnlyFans model Victoria Triece, who had a similar situation regarding her child’s school when officials told her she couldn’t volunteer anymore because of her account.

“When Victoria’s story hit I messaged her because she had found an attorney willing to take on an OnlyFans case. I had a similar situation with being banned from my kids’ football organizations because I did OnlyFans. They erased me from my kids’ lives and humiliated me for what I did in private by exposing that secret.”

The OnlyFans model added that celebrities do not experience the same form of criticism for participating in sex scenes or nude scenes.

“A celebrity can film sex scenes or be topless in a movie and be praised for a weird baby name they give to their children. This is no different other than the fact we are giving our kids normal suburban lives.  Having your rights as a mother, a good one at that, taken by someone else for providing, is unimaginably the worst feeling in the world.”

She said her son was forced out of school without any explanation and had to take homeschooling courses to make up for the work in before he was enrolled in another school. Creek plans to hold the principal accountable for their response towards her account.

“I also want to note I never fought the suspension. I just wanted to talk to the principal and hold her accountable for not being able to do her job without bias solely based on what a kid deserves without involving his parent.”

Creek’s supporters also commented on her situation and said it was sad that her son had to suffer because of something he didn’t have any control over.
